Background technique
Vacuum generator be exactly generated using positive pressure gas source negative pressure one kind is novel, efficient, cleaning, economical, small-sized true
Empty component, this makes in the place for having compressed air, or needs the place of positive/negative-pressure to obtain simultaneously in a pneumatic system
Negative pressure becomes very easy and conveniently.Vacuum generator has been widely used in multiple industrial circles, for example, machinery, electronics,
Packaging, printing etc..Vacuum generator is generally used cooperatively with sucker, to carry out various materials for adsorbing to carry.Traditional is true
When empty generator adsorbs different objects, different objects mainly is adsorbed using size, shape or the material for changing sucker
Body, still, the vacuum degree of vacuum generator is there is no changing, since the sucker of unlike material has different requirements to vacuum degree,
In this way if the limit value that vacuum degree has been more than sucker will result in the damage of sucker, production cost is increased.In addition, if it is
Using and vacuum generator the sucker that matches of vacuum degree and frequently replace sucker, in this way can be not only time-consuming but also reduce production
Efficiency.

The utility model has the following beneficial effects: the vacuum generator of the utility model, in use, compressed gas is through spray nozzle part
Into, enter jet pipe through admission line and be discharged again by outlet pipe, so that forming negative pressure at vacuum pipe, generates vacuum,
By the way that regulating mechanism is arranged on spray nozzle part, when the air pressure of compressed gas is excessive, portion gas can be adjusted channel and push tune
Section piston compression adjustment spring enters in adjusting cavity to be vented from exhaust passage, thus reduce into the air pressure in jet pipe, from
And vacuum magnitude is reduced, and then adjust the size of vacuum degree.And spring base is movably arranged in adjusting cavity by screw thread,
By rotation spring seat, thus the decrement of adjustment spring, and then adjust spring and be applied to the elastic force on regulating piston, to adjust
Section pushes air pressure size required for regulating piston, to control the size of the gas pressure entered in jet pipe, by above-mentioned
Adjust can reduce avoid because vacuum degree it is excessive caused by destruction to sucker or object.Also, adjustment structure is simple to operation, mentions
High production efficiency.

The vacuum generator of the utility model enters through admission line 6 and sprays in use, compressed gas enters through spray nozzle part 2
Feed channel 3 is discharged by outlet pipe 4 again, so that forming negative pressure at vacuum pipe 5, vacuum is generated, by being arranged on spray nozzle part 2
Regulating mechanism, when the air pressure of compressed gas is excessive, portion gas can be adjusted channel 9 and push 11 compression adjustment bullet of regulating piston
Spring 13 enters in adjusting cavity 8 to be vented from exhaust passage 10, to reduce into the air pressure in jet pipe 3, to reduce negative pressure
Size, and then adjust the size of vacuum degree.And spring base 12 is movably arranged in adjusting cavity 8 by screw thread, by turning
Flexible spring seat 12, thus the decrement of adjustment spring 13, and then adjust spring and be applied to the elastic force on regulating piston 11, to adjust
Section pushes air pressure size required for regulating piston 11, to control the size of the gas pressure entered in jet pipe 3, to adjust
Save vacuum degree size, can reduce by above-mentioned adjusting avoid because vacuum degree it is excessive caused by destruction to sucker or object.Also,
Adjustment structure is simple to operation, improves production efficiency.
